Looks great.  I thought that the rumble collection was not available yet.  I have looked at HD.com and did a search here.  what gives and can you supply the part numbers for them.  Thanks, Ted

The Rumble pegs and inserts can be found in the MoCo parts books for the CVO models. Just have a parts guy at the dealer look them up for you.

I saved some coin by taking the Swept Wing passenger assemblies off my old FLHTC and then just changing the inserts. With the black frame on mine the black mounting brackets look fine.

Buy the balls and springs for a 05 SEEG that way they are the hard plastic ( the balls ) and rust won't run out between the peg and bracket. I have used them on a couple bikes, no problems.
